在Java开发过程中,真机调试是一个非常重要的环节,它可以帮助开发者更准确地模拟用户的使用场景,发现和修复潜在的问题,以下是在Java中使用真机调试的详细步骤:

准备工作
| 步骤 | 描述 |
|---|---|
| 1 安装Android Studio | Android Studio是Android开发的主要IDE,它提供了强大的调试工具,确保你的Android Studio版本是最新的。 |
| 2 创建或打开项目 | 如果你还没有项目,请创建一个新的Android项目,如果你已经有了项目,请打开它。 |
| 3 配置Android设备 | 确保你的Android设备已经开启开发者模式,并且已经连接到你的电脑。 |
连接Android设备
| 步骤 | 描述 |
|---|---|
| 1 打开Android设备开发者模式 | 进入“设置”>“系统”>“开发者选项”,开启“开发者模式”。 |
| 2 连接设备 | 使用USB线将Android设备连接到电脑。 |
| 3 允许USB调试 | 在设备上,当出现“允许USB调试”的提示时,选择“始终允许”或“仅在此设备上”。 |
配置调试选项
| 步骤 | 描述 |
|---|---|
| 1 启动调试器 | 在Android Studio中,点击工具栏上的“运行”按钮,然后选择“运行”或“调试”。 |
| 2 选择调试配置 | 在弹出的对话框中,选择你的Android设备作为调试目标。 |
| 3 启动调试 | 点击“开始调试”按钮,Android Studio将自动启动你的应用,并进入调试模式。 |
使用调试工具
| 工具 | 描述 |
|---|---|
| 1 断点 | 在代码中设置断点,当程序运行到断点处时会暂停执行。 |
| 2 单步执行 | 单步执行可以帮助你逐步跟踪程序的执行过程。 |
| 3 查看变量值 | 在调试过程中,你可以查看变量的值,以便更好地理解程序的执行状态。 |
| 4 监视表达式 | 监视表达式可以帮助你跟踪变量的变化。 |
调试技巧
| 技巧 | 描述 |
|---|---|
| 1 使用日志输出 | 在代码中添加日志输出,可以帮助你了解程序的执行过程。 |
| 2 使用Android Studio的调试视图 | Android Studio提供了丰富的调试视图,可以帮助你更好地理解程序的执行状态。 |
| 3 使用性能分析工具 | 使用性能分析工具可以帮助你发现和修复性能问题。 |
FAQs
Q1:如何查看Android设备日志?
A1: 在Android Studio中,你可以使用Logcat工具来查看Android设备的日志,在Logcat中,你可以选择不同的标签来过滤日志信息,以便快速找到你想要的信息。

Q2:如何设置断点?
A2: 在代码中,你可以通过鼠标左键点击行号来设置断点,设置断点后,当程序运行到该行时,会自动暂停执行,你可以通过点击工具栏上的“继续执行”按钮来继续执行程序。

原创文章,发布者:酷盾叔,转转请注明出处:https://www.kd.cn/ask/204089.html